The error often appears when the target is an OAuth2-protected API. If your access token has expired and the WFM module does not have a refresh token flow implemented, the handshake fails, resulting in code 14-7.
Modern WFM "Target" integrations often rely on secure web sockets or HTTPS APIs to pull data. If the Target system updates its security certificates but the WFM trust store is not updated, the handshake fails. wfm-14-7 error code target

Target systems often impose rate limits (e.g., 100 requests per minute). If the WFM module exceeds this, the target responds with 429 Too Many Requests . Without proper retry logic, the WFM logs this as a 14-7 target failure.
